Overview

Rosa moyesii 'Geranium' is a bushy shrub in the genus Rosa, part of the Rosaceae family, with deciduous foliage. It typically grows around 4.0 m tall. Rosa moyesii 'Geranium' grows best in full sun, and tolerates most soils and neutral pH. Its UK hardiness is rated H7. Suggested uses include flower borders and beds, hedging and screens and cut flowers. It is native to China.

About the genus

A rose is either a woody perennial flowering plant of the genus Rosa, in the family Rosaceae, or the flower it bears. There are over three hundred species and tens of thousands of cultivars. The plants range in size and form, from trailing and erect shrubs to climbers up to 7 metres (23 ft) in height.
